Grace Islet is a recognized centuries old First Nations burial ground on Salt Spring Island BC, that is zoned residential. In an attempt to satisfy both concerns, British Columbia’s Archaeology Branch decided to allow an Alberta businessman to build his waterfront vacation home on Grace Islet providing he put it on stilts that go over the grave sites.

Protesting Service Cuts to an Overpriced BC Ferry System

Thousands of people may be descending on Victoria on March 11, protesting service cuts to an overpriced BC Ferry System.

Notices have been posted in local webpages like the Salt Spring Exchange and Cortes Island Tideline  Buses are accepting a $10 donation to transport passengers from Campbell River to Victoria, so that demonstrators can “make it back for dinner time!” Another bus will be leaving the Sunshine Coast at 6:20 am and will reach  Victoria at 11:30. On April 1, 2014, the BC Ferries system intends to cut 7,000 sailings.
